Fourth one-day international, Barnsley: New Zealand (136-9) lost to England (139-1) by nine wickets Match scorecard
 Claire Taylor's unbeaten fifty guided England over the line with the bat |
England's women thrashed New Zealand by nine wickets to claim victory in their one-day international series after taking an unassailable 3-1 lead. A superb bowling display restricted the Kiwis to just 136-9 from 50 overs. Katherine Brunt took three wickets, Jenny Gunn and Holly Colvin claimed two apiece while Isa Guha conceded only 11 runs from her 10 overs in Barnsley. Claire Taylor (51 not out) and Sarah Taylor (49 not out) steered England home with 23 balls to spare. The two Taylors came together after the dismissal of Heather Knight for 18 in the 18th over and put on an unbroken stand of 98. Claire Taylor's half-century came off 92 balls with six fours and a six, but it was left to Sarah Taylor to complete the rout with a four off Suzie Bates. "It was great batting with Claire Taylor, she kept me going," said namesake Sarah. "The Kiwis bowled well, but we were patient and the runs just came." The fifth and final one-day international is at Lord's on Tuesday.
